Nominations for the June 2023 Ministerial Elections

In accordance with Article 6, Section 1 of the Third Constitution of the Social Liberal Union, a Ministerial election is now triggered.

I, Maelstrom Republic, will serve as Election Administrator and shall execute the duties of this role to the best of my ability.
The powers and duties of the Ministerial positions are primarily detailed in Article 6 of the Constitution, but more digestible outlines may be found at these locations:
Minister of Foreign Affairs
Minister of Domestic Affairs
Minister of Immigration



Nominations shall begin on 17:40 UTC on 25 May 2023, and shall last for seven (7) days, concluding at 17:40 UTC on 1 June 2023, after which voting shall commence.

Any eligible Member State may nominate themselves or another eligible Member State, subject to their acceptance, for any Ministerial position.
Eligibility Requirements
A candidate for Ministerial office must be a current Member State not otherwise disqualified from holding office by the Court of Justice.
